ROCHDALE VILLAGE INC.

Dear Applicant,

We welcome your interest in becoming a cooperator at Rochdale Village, Inc.

Rochdale Village, Inc. is situated on 120 acres that was once home to the Jamaica Race Track. The village is composed of a total of twenty (20) buildings, divided into five groups. Each group contains four buildings and each building has three sections with their own mailing address.

On site are shopping centers, nursery and public schools, basketball and tennis facilities, a community center and senior center services. Rochdale Village is patrolled by its own security force.

Rochdale Village is convenient to public transportation, including the Long Island Railroad, local and express buses to Manhattan; minutes away from major highways and close to Nassau County, major beaches and recreation areas.

HOW TO SUBMIT YOUR APPLICATION:

When returning this pre-application, include a $25.00 non-refundable money order processing fee payable to Rochdale Village, Inc. Mail to:

Rochdale Village, Inc.

P.O. Box 218

Jamaica, N.Y. 11434.

PROCESSING FEES MUST BE PAID BY MONEY ORDER ONLY

Only original pre-applications will be accepted (no duplications).

Rochdale Village, Inc. will reject applicants whose tenancy or credit record is inconsistent, or who have a recent history of serious deficiencies in overall credit or in rent payment or general tenancy, including, but not limited to, any credit flaws such as bankruptcy, eviction proceedings, lateness in credit payment, late in rent or mortgage payments, and the need for third party co- signers. Credit rating must be 680 or above.

Rochdale Village, Inc. reserves the right to reject applicants based on negative Home Visit reports and/or Criminal Background reports.

ROCHDALE VILLAGE INC.

Family composition for apartments must meet the New York State Homes and

Community Renewal (HCR) occupancy standards as follows:

Apartment size

Allowable Household Composition

1

Bedroom

1 or 2 Persons

2

Bedrooms

2 to 4 Persons

3

Bedrooms

4 to 6 Persons

VETERANS’ PREFERENCE: Preference is given to all veterans, or their surviving spouses, who served on active duty in time of war as defined in Section 85 of the Civil Service Law, and reside in New York State.

ROCHDALE VILLAGE INC.

Please Read and Sign Below

(A)SPECIFICALLY UNDERSTAND THAT THE FILING OF THIS PRE- APPLICATION DOES NOT IN ANY WAY BIND ROCHDALE VILLAGE INC. TO RESERVE OR ASSIGN AN APARTMENT TO ME.

(B)ANY SOLICITATION OR ACCEPTANCE OF GRATUITY TO OBTAIN AN APARTMENT IS ABSOLUTELY PROHIBITED BY ROCHDALE

VILLAGE INC. AND IS ILLEGAL.

(C)I understand that in order to be accepted as an approved applicant, I am required to attend one (1) mandatory orientation session. All applicants are subject to a full credit investigation, including a home visit at the time of offering of apartment.

(D)All applicants accepting apartments will be responsible for supplying their own stove and refrigerator (electric stoves are not allowed).

(E)Rochdale Village, Inc. does not permit dogs, cats, washing machines, clothes dryers, air conditioners or freezers.

(F)I certify that the statements made in this pre-application are true and complete. I have no objections to inquiries for the purpose of verifying the facts stated.
